European ministers agreed on Monday to add eight Iranians and
one of the Tehran government’s most powerful bodies to EU sanctions
lists, Trend reports
citing Al
Arabiya.
The individuals – including clerics, judges and a broadcaster –
are accused of playing leading roles in Iran’s brutal crackdown on
anti-government protests.
The EU said it was in particular “sanctioning members of the
judiciary responsible for handing down death sentences in unfair
trials and for the torturing of convicts”.
